Lawyers Should Not Be Used Car Sales People

The sad truth is that some attorneys can make divorces worse. You will know those attorneys when you meet them. Those used car sales attorneys do not want to educate you about the process and they do not want you to make your own decisions. They are rude to other counsel and they act like your divorce is their personal divorce. They are not objective and they tell you what you want to know instead of what really is. That lawyer does not listen to what is most important to you. It is a bit like being on a used car lot and driving off with a clunker. You will know when it is being jammed down your throat. So, how do you know a good, competent, experienced attorney? You might not remember what they told you, but you will remember how they made you feel. Do you feel like they care? Do you feel like they listened? You will know.
